We are seeking a skilled and compassionate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etist (CRNA) to join our anesthesia care team. The CRNA will be responsible for administering intravenous, inhalation, and regional anesthetics to render patients insensible to pain during surgical procedures, obstetrical deliveries, or other medical and dental procedures. The CRNA may administer anesthesia to all ages and A.S.A. class patients, including geriatrics and pediatrics, and provides airway management services as needed throughout the hospital.
Work-Life- Henry Ford Rochester Hospital has 180 beds and 11 operating rooms providing Cardiovascular, Vascular, Neurology, General, ENT (with limited pediatrics), Urology, Orthopedic, Robotic, Colo-Rectal, Podiatry, and Plastic surgery. We cover a full scope of out‑of‑department services including Non‑invasive cardiology, OB, Endoscopy, and radiology (including CT and MRI).
- On‑call and weekend shifts occur once every 1–2 months. Rotating shifts with flexible scheduling.
- Conduct pre‑anesthesia assessments and develop tailored anesthesia care plans.
- Administer anesthesia (general, regional, or monitored anesthesia care) in collaboration with surgeons and other healthcare providers.
- Monitor patients during procedures and manage any anesthesia‑related complications.
- Provide post‑anesthesia care and pain management.
- Maintain accurate documentation in accordance with hospital policies and regulatory standards.
